Mnqobi Yazo Releases His Spiritual & Culturally Rooted Album 'Ubhoko'

By @MasechabaKganyapa on 01/26/2024 in Projects You Should Hear

Today, Mnqobi Yazo releases his latest album titled 'Ubhoko,' a powerful musical journey deeply rooted in spirituality and cultural significance. The title, when translated from the Nguni language, means "War Stick," a metaphor for the battles faced in life.

After a hiatus of almost four years, Mnqobi Yazo returns with a 19-track album. The album features handpicked collaborations with notable artists such as Yallunder, Njilour, Ndabaz, Igcokama Elisha and Olefied Khetha.

'Ubhoko' takes listeners on a profound exploration of heritage, love, and the essence of African descent. Mnqobi Yazo addresses critical social issues such as mental health, love and fostering a positive mindset. The album serves as a cultural mirror, reflecting the realities and aspirations of a diverse audience.
